So, here in the lovely state of VA, some counties have county stickers that need to replaced every year. You can only get it if you pay the fee and pay all your property taxes. So, two weeks ago, I get a letter that I have underpaid my taxes. They were taxing me on a boat we no longer own.

After I got that straightened out, they said the sticker would be put right in the mail. Well, here it is the 11th, they are supposed to be put on today, or you risk getting a ticket.

I ask you, how can I possibly drive to the tax assessor's office to get a sticker if I can get ticketed for not having one?
